TO be sold, pursuant to a Decree of the High Court of Chancery, before Anthony Allen, Esq; one of the Masters of the said Court, at his House in Breame's Buildings near Chancery Lane, London, The real Estates of the Reverend John Day, Clerk, deceased, consisting of a Freehold Farm, in the Parish of Fletching in the County of Sussex, lett to Thomas Keeys at 30 l. per Annum. And of another Freehold Farm, in the Parish of Cowden in the County of Kent, lett to William Berry at13 l. per Annum. Particulars whereof may be had at the said Master’s House.
